Book Experimental Heat Transfer  Fluid Mechanics  and Thermodynamics  1988

Download or read book Experimental Heat Transfer Fluid Mechanics and Thermodynamics 1988 written by R. K. Shah and published by Elsevier Publishing Company. This book was released on 1988-01-01 with total page 1783 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In this authoritative proceedings, over 220 research, keynote, and invited papers present the results of experimental investigations conducted throughout the world over the past five years. Keynote papers in Experimental Heat Transfer, Fluid Mechanics, and Thermodynamics 1988 focus on the latest advances in experimental techniques used in thermal and fluid science. Using the International System of Units (SI) throughout, the volume includes contributed research papers that feature experimental methods, phenomenological and analytical/numerical modeling, and analysis of fundamentals and applications. Invited papers review fundamentals and applications in specific areas including: Thermal Radiation and Insulation Systems; Heat Transfer Augmentation; Magnetohydrodynamics; Jet Expansion Measurements in Two-Phase Flow Systems, Forced Convection in High-Temperature Systems; Internal and External Laminar Flows; Gas-Solid and Liquid-Solid Two-Phase Flows; and Axisymmetric and Rotating Flows.

Book Bluff Body Wakes  Dynamics and Instabilities

Download or read book Bluff Body Wakes Dynamics and Instabilities written by Helmut Eckelmann and published by Springer Science & Business Media. This book was released on 2013-11-11 with total page 390 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Bluff-body wakes play an important role in many fluid dynamics problems and engineering applications. This book gives and up-to-date account of recent results obtained in the study of bluff-body wakes. Experimental, theoretical and numerical approaches are all comprehensively covered and compared. Topics of particular interest include hydrodynamic instability analyses, three-dimensional pattern formation problems, flow control methods, bifurcation analyses, numerical simulations and turbulence modelling. The main originality of thisvolume is that recent conceptual advances made to describe nonlinear phenomena in general are put to the test on a classical problem in fundamental fluid mechanics, namely the wake structure generated behind a bluff object.
